2026 March Break Girls Rep Nike Volleyball Camp Oshawa

Girls Only | Ages 14–17 (Rep-Level Athletes)

This March Break Girls Rep Nike Volleyball Camp in Oshawa is a rep-level training experience designed for motivated female athletes ages 14–17. The camp follows proven Nike Camp standards, featuring elite coaching, excellent facilities, and a low coach-to-athlete ratio to maximize on-court reps and individual feedback.

Athletes will be grouped by age and level within the 14–17 range, allowing for appropriate pacing, competitive balance, and focused development throughout the week.

This camp is a 5 day camp running March 16 -20, 2026 with both Full Day and Half Day options.

TRAINING FOCUS
  • High-intensity on-court reps emphasizing consistency, efficiency, and competitive execution
  • Technical training in serving, passing, setting, attacking, and defense
  • Tactical concepts, game situations, and decision-making under pressure
  • Position-specific and situational drills to strengthen overall game awareness and team play

CAMP HIGHLIGHTS

  • Elite coaching and individual attention: under Coach Pylyp’s leadership, athletes receive direct instruction and personalized feedback in a focused rep-training environment
  • Competitive drills, games, and scrimmage play: sessions are designed to challenge athletes and simulate match-like situations
  • Nike camp gear and awards: every participant receives a Nike Volleyball Camp T-shirt and has the opportunity to earn daily awards
  • Strong team culture: the camp promotes accountability, work ethic, and support, helping athletes grow together and compete with confidence
  • Prep for Rep: Designed for rep club players on teams who are competing on a Regional, Provincial and National level with OVL, OVA and VC

Pylyp Harmash | Head Coach

Head Coach and Technical Director of Unity Volleyball, decorated international player and member of the Team Ontario Red coaching staff (2025–2026). Pylyp brings elite playing experience and high-level coaching expertise, creating an environment where competitive athletes are challenged, supported, and pushed to perform at their best.

As a volleyball player, Coach Pylyp has represented Ukraine on various prestigious platforms, earning numerous accolades and victories as (5 times champion of Ukraine, 3 times bronze medalist of Ukrainian championship ,4 times Ukrainian Cup owner , 2 times world Silver medalist of World universities games 2011 , 2015 , 2013-2019 Ukraine National team member .his athleticism, strategic play, and commitment to the sport have made him a standout player in the volleyball.

Fueled by a wealth of knowledge and a desire to contribute to the sport, Pylyp made the transition to the Canada . Now, as the Head Coach and technical director , Pylyp takes immense pleasure in sharing his extensive volleyball experience with aspiring athletes. Having navigated different levels of play, Pylyp possess a keen understanding of how to prepare future volleyball stars and guide them toward their aspirations.

Fern Arias | Coach

Fernando “Fern” Arias has over 30 years of coaching experience, beginning in basketball (1996–2019) before transitioning into volleyball. He now specializes in rep volleyball, coaching teen representative athletes and focusing on developing high-performance players.

Coach Fern emphasizes skill development and performance training to build the technical ability and competitive mindset required for high-level volleyball.

A career highlight includes assisting at the Ontario Volleyball High Performance Camp (August 2018).

Known for creating disciplined, supportive, and motivating environments, Coach Fern challenges athletes to train with purpose and compete with confidence.
